COR-OTICIN is a combination product containing hydrocortisone (a corticosteroid with anti-inflammatory and immunosuppressive properties) and neomycin (an aminoglycoside antibiotic that inhibits bacterial protein synthesis by binding to the 30S ribosomal subunit) and polymyxin B (a polymyxin antibiotic that disrupts bacterial cell membrane permeability).
Septra Grape (trimethoprim/sulfamethoxazole) inhibits bacterial folic acid synthesis via sequential blockade: sulfamethoxazole inhibits dihydropteroate synthase, and trimethoprim inhibits dihydrofolate reductase, leading to bactericidal activity.
